Indian agriculture is undergoing a significant transformation, thanks to the integration of technology. Once reliant on traditional methods, farmers are now embracing innovative tools and techniques to improve efficiency, productivity, and sustainability. This shift is crucial for feeding a growing population and ensuring the economic well-being of farmers.
One of the most impactful technologies is precision agriculture. This approach uses data from sensors, drones, and satellites to monitor crop health, soil conditions, and weather patterns in real-time. Farmers can then make informed decisions about irrigation, fertilisation, and pest control, applying resources only where and when they are needed. This not only saves costs but also reduces environmental impact by minimising the use of water and chemicals.
Drones are becoming indispensable farm equipment. They can cover large areas quickly to assess crop health, detect early signs of disease or pest infestation, and even deliver targeted treatments. This aerial perspective provides farmers with valuable insights that were previously difficult or impossible to obtain.
Another area of rapid development is the use of sensors. Soil moisture sensors help farmers optimise irrigation schedules, preventing both water scarcity and waterlogging. Weather stations provide localised forecasts, allowing farmers to plan activities like planting and harvesting more effectively. Data from these sensors is often fed into farm management software, creating a comprehensive digital picture of the farm.
Farm management software and apps are also playing a key role. These digital tools help farmers track expenses, manage inventory, record yields, and plan farm operations. Many apps provide access to market information, helping farmers get better prices for their produce. They also offer advice on best farming practices and connect farmers with experts.
In the realm of irrigation, smart irrigation systems are gaining traction. These systems can automatically adjust watering based on soil moisture levels and weather forecasts, ensuring crops receive the optimal amount of water without waste.
For livestock farmers, technology offers solutions for animal health monitoring and management. Wearable sensors can track the activity levels, temperature, and other vital signs of animals, alerting farmers to potential health issues early on. This proactive approach leads to healthier animals and improved productivity.
The government is also supporting this technological shift through various initiatives and subsidies, encouraging farmers to adopt modern farming techniques. Training programs and workshops are being organised to educate farmers about these new technologies and how to use them effectively.
While the adoption of technology is not without its challenges, such as initial costs and the need for digital literacy, the benefits are undeniable. Smart farming promises a future where Indian agriculture is more resilient, efficient, and profitable, contributing significantly to the nation’s economy and food security.
